WebMar 16, 2024 · Blind baking is the process of pre-baking a pie crust or tart shell before its filling is added. It gives the crust a head-start over the filling, and gives you more control over how the crust is baked. You can create a barrier between the filling and the dough by adding an ingredient that won't change the flavor of the pie. Sprinkle dried breadcrumbs or crushed cornflakes, or other types of cereal, on the bottom crust before filling and baking in the oven. This will prevent the filling from turning the crust soggy.

WebJul 1, 2024 · What temperature do you bake a pie at? Most fruit pies bake at a temperature between 350 degrees F ( 175 degrees C ) and 450 degrees F ( 230 degrees C ). Some recipes call for baking the pie in a 450 degree F oven to begin with, then turning down the oven to about 350 degrees F.

WebAug 9, 2024 · How to Blind Bake a Pie Crust Begin by rolling out your round of dough, then fit it into the pie plate and trim the excess. Most recipes call for docking the dough, which just means to poke the bottom with a fork; this should prevent the dough from puffing up as it bakes. Chill the pie shell for 15 to 30 minutes.
